Cypress Test Automation for Beginners

Why take this course?
🚀 Course Title: Cypress Test Automation for Beginners
🎓 Course Headline: Learn Fundamentals of Test Automation in Cypress with Real-World Examples
Discover the Art of Efficient Test Automation with Cypress! 🤔
Are you pondering over whether test automation is the right career path for you? Are you searching for a course that dives deep into real-life scenarios without overwhelming you with endless hours of lecture? Do you crave a concise, yet comprehensive learning experience? If these questions resonate with you, then this is the perfect course to kickstart your journey into Cypress Test Automation! 🛠️✨
Why Choose This Course?
- Personalized Learning: Designed with your needs in mind, this course addresses common queries about test automation.
- Real-World Examples: No theoretical waffle here! We'll focus on practical applications to solidify your understanding.
- Time-Efficient: A condensed learning experience that delivers maximum value without wasting your precious time.
Course Structure:
-
Introduction to Cypress Test Automation: 🎬
- Understanding the basics of what test automation is and how it fits into modern software development.
-
Your First Test in Cypress: 🧪
- We'll start by writing your very first E2E test together. I'll guide you through each component:
- Test Suite & Test Structure
- Visiting Page
- Selecting Elements Using Browser Dev Tools
- Performing Actions on Selected Elements
- Assertions
- We'll start by writing your very first E2E test together. I'll guide you through each component:
-
Improving Your Tests: 🏗️
- Learn best practices to enhance the quality and efficiency of your tests.
- Dive into custom commands to make your tests more readable.
- Explore methods for generating dynamic test data.
-
Boosting Your Development Environment: 🛠️
- Discover powerful VS code extensions that will supercharge your Cypress testing workflow.
-
Best Practices and Beyond: 🌟
- Gain insights into creating maintainable and scalable tests.
- Understand how to integrate Cypress with your CI/CD pipeline for seamless automation.
What You Will Learn:
- Writing and Understanding Cypress Tests: Learn the nuts and bolts of E2E testing with hands-on practice.
- Best Practices for Test Writing: Write clean, maintainable, and reliable tests that will serve you well in your career.
- Custom Commands: Create your own commands to make your test suite more readable and reusable.
- Dynamic Data Generation: Learn techniques to feed real data into your tests without manual intervention.
- VS Code Extensions: Unlock the power of VS code extensions to boost your productivity in Cypress.
Who Is This Course For?
- Beginners to Test Automation who want to start with Cypress.
- Developers and testers looking to enhance their current skill set with test automation.
- Anyone interested in learning efficient, real-world testing practices with a focus on Cypress.
Join me on this exciting journey into the world of Cypress Test Automation for Beginners! I'm here to guide you every step of the way. 🚀 Let's write some tests together and unlock your potential in test automation! 🎉
See you in class, and let's make learning fun and rewarding! 💻💕
Loading charts...